New in macOS Big Sur 11 beta, the system ships with a built-in dynamic linker cache of all system-provided libraries. As part of this change, copies of dynamic libraries are no longer present on the filesystem. Code that attempts to check for dynamic library presence by looking for a file at a path or enumerating a directory will fail. Instead, check for library presence by attempting to dlopen()
the path, which will correctly check for the library in the cache. (62986286)

New APIs are available for using os
from Swift as part of the os framework:
A new type Logger
can be instantiated using a subsystem and category and provides methods for logging at different levels ( debug(_:)
, error(_:)
, fault(_:)
).
The Logger
APIs support specifying most formatting and privacy options supported by legacy os
APIs.
The new APIs provide significant performance improvements over the legacy APIs.
You can now pass Swift string interpolation to the os
function.
Note: The new APIs can't be back deployed; however, the existing os
API remains available for back deployment. (22539144)

Support for Web Extensions is now available. Existing Chrome and Firefox extensions can be converted for Safari using xcrun safari-web-extension-converter
and distributed through the App Store for use in Safari 14. (55707949)
Webpage Translation is now available in the U.S. and Canada. Supported languages include English, Spanish, Simplified Chinese, French, German, Russian, and Brazilian Portuguese. Safari will automatically detect if translation is available based on your Preferred Languages list. (64437861)

APFS-formatted backup volumes are now supported for faster, more compact, and more reliable backups. New local and network Time Machine backup destinations are formatted as APFS by default. Time Machine will continue backing up to existing HFS backup volumes. (65155545)
